Emotional intelligence plays a crucial role in helping individuals approach problems with a flexible and open mindset. Here's an in-depth explanation of how emotional intelligence facilitates this:
1. Self-Awareness: Emotional intelligence starts with self-awareness, which involves recognizing and understanding one's own emotions, thoughts, and biases. Self-awareness allows individuals to identify their default thinking patterns and any rigid beliefs or preconceptions they may hold. By being aware of these tendencies, individuals can consciously challenge and question their own perspectives, allowing for a more flexible and open mindset when approaching problems.
2. Emotion Regulation: Emotional intelligence enables individuals to regulate their emotions effectively. When faced with challenging problems, it's natural for emotions like frustration, stress, or fear to arise. However, individuals with high emotional intelligence can recognize and manage these emotions in a constructive manner.
